**Runbook fragment — autocomplete index rebuild**

Plugin authors: when the Fernquery autocomplete index degrades, do not ship workaround caching in your plugin. Instead, trigger a managed rebuild via `fernctl index rebuild --scope=plugin`. Rebuilds run incrementally and may take up to forty minutes; query latency recovers gradually, so avoid premature retries. Once rebuilt, publish your plugin's updated index manifest to the registry. Publishing requires signing the manifest with the key provided below.

rollout seal: bky9_PeXH1fTLY

If the Quillhaven autoscaler stops reacting to queue depth and the on-call engineer is unreachable, support may use break-glass access to pause or override scaling decisions. This applies only when ticket backlog exceeds the red threshold on the Larkspur dashboard. Open the break-glass console, select the autoscaler service, and confirm with your team lead verbally. Log every action in the incident channel. The console will prompt for the emergency recovery passphrase, which is provided below.

vault phrase of tawig-taduf = zorath-oliwyn

v3.1.0 — Added idempotency keys to payment retries in the Ledgerbird gateway. Each retry now carries the original attempt's key, so duplicate charges from network flaps or client double-submits are rejected server-side. Keys expire after 24 hours and are stored in the dedupe table with a unique constraint. Migration included; backfill is optional but recommended. Reviewers should focus on the key-derivation logic and the expiry sweep. Questions about design decisions should go to the responsible engineer named below.

account owner for bawip-tahag: Raleth Quenok

Subject: Audit-Log Viewer — ready for release cut

Hi all,

The Lanternfell audit-log viewer has passed staging checks. Filtering by actor and date range works, export to CSV is capped at 50k rows as agreed, and the redaction toggle is admin-only. No open blockers remain from the Tarnwick review. Please include this in Friday's release train. The build to promote is identified by the token below.

pipeline stamp: htk4_ae36